+// The declaration of liborigin's OPJFile::colType() changed from
+// const char *OPJFile::colType(int, int) const;
+// in version 20071119 to
+// ColumnType OPJFile::colType(int, int) const;
+// in version 20080225. This function can be used to get the string
+// that colType() returned in liborigin/20071119 from the ColumnType
+// that colType() returns in liborigin/20080225. The use of this
+// function requires a build-dependency on liborigin (>= 20080225).
+QString colTypeToString(const ColumnType type) {
+ QString type_str = "";
+
+ switch (type) {
+ case X:
+ type_str = "X";
+ break;
+ case Y:
+ type_str = "Y";
+ break;
+ case Z:
+ type_str = "Z";
+ break;
+ case XErr:
+ type_str = "DX";
+ break;
+ case YErr:
+ type_str = "DY";
+ break;
+ case Label:
+ type_str = "LABEL";
+ break;
+ case NONE:
+ type_str = "NONE";
+ break;
+ }
+
+ return type_str;
+}

+// <liborigin/OPJFile.h> defines an enumerator of the type ColumnType with
+// the name Label in the global namespace. Since the class Label defined in
+// this file ("Label.h") collides with the aforementioned enumerator in
+// "ImportOPJ.cc" we define a synonym for Label here to avoid the ambiguity.
+typedef Label LPLabel;
